What can I see and do near Beit el-Sahel (Palace Museum)?
House of Wonders, Freddie Mercury Museum and People's Palace Museum feature a variety of fascinating exhibits to see while you're in town. Old Fort, Slave Market and Mbweni Ruins are monuments to see when you're exploring the area around Beit el-Sahel (Palace Museum). Local parks like Forodhani Gardens, Prison Island and Chapwani Island are peaceful spots to stop and take in some fresh air.
